Ubuntu Version: 12.04 (all updates installed)
Package version: 5.8.0-0ubuntu2

If you turn the taskbar 100% transparent, the text overlays from the global menu never dissapear.

The first time you re-maximize a program from the unity bar, the text on the taskbar is fine. When you hover over the taskbar to take a look at the menu, the name of the program turns black, and the menu names go over it. The name of the program is still easily visible.

This goes for any change of text in that area. Browsing to a page with a different name has the same effect. As long as the program stays open, the black text underlay remains.

After a while, the underlay is cleared, and it looks as it should.

Ive attached a screenshot of what is going on (as its hard to explain)

It sometimes happens even if the menu is not changed.
